A fiberglass laminator fabricator is responsible for constructing and repairing fiberglass products. They work with fiberglass materials, such as sheets, fabrics, resins, and molds, to create a variety of items, including boats, car parts, and architectural structures. Their tasks include measuring and cutting fiberglass materials, applying resins and catalysts, laminating layers of fiberglass, and shaping and finishing the final product. They must also ensure that safety procedures are followed during the fabrication process.

Fiberglass Laminator Fabricator salary in Australia
Average Yearly Salary of Fiberglass Laminator Fabricator in Australia is approximately 75,069 AUD (37,546 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
